Virtualisation 'makes companies stronger'


03 Jun 2009

Companies can strengthen their operations by adopting virtualisation, it has been claimed.

Danny Guillory, chief executive officer of training provider and consultancy Innovations International, explains that the benefits of virtualisation can reach beyond simple cost savings.

"The bottom line is, virtualisation can create a stronger organisation where employees work efficiently and with the balance that working from home can offer," he says.

But he adds that there are financial benefits to be derived from virtualisation as well, through the reduction in energy costs and the lower overheads associated with the move away from a centralised business location.

Mr Guillory's insight is drawn from his own experience of guiding Innovations International through the virtualisation process, creating a company network which spans eight states in the US.

Dr William A Guillory, a seminar facilitator at Innovations International, writes in his book The Living Organization that decentralisation and greater flexibility are among two of the main benefits that he has seen in clients of the consultancy since it opened in 1994..
